Iron Fan's View On Cardiff City Game

Cardiff City travel to play already relegated Scunthorpe United this weekend needing maximum points. We spoke to Scunny fan Ian Jackson ahead of the game:



Already relegated - how would you describe this season?


Painful! When we look at the other teams we came up with: Blackpool looking nearly safe and Bristol City going for promotion its very tough. Especially as we were champions last year...



What went wrong over the season?


I was very happy with the start we made, but since November we've won very few games and not once can I remember us going on a run. Back-to-back wins is how you climb this division and we never did that.


Is it the manager's fault?


I don't have a problem with Nigel Adkins, but I believe the whole club, manager included was not geared up for a Championship season. I think he ought to stay, but we need a big turn-around.



Any bright spots to the season?


Beating Charlton, a 3-2 win over Sheffield United last year and Martin Paterson's goals.



Fancy doing us a favour on Saturday?

I sincerely hope not! There's still pride, preparation for next season and I'd like to think we'll do all we can to stay above Colchester and not finish bottom!



If you could have one Cardiff player on a free - who and why?


Not sure really so I'll say this Ramsey kid everyone is talking about. We'll take him, sell him on and buy a 7 good new players!



Scunthorpe United player to watch?


Martin Paterson. I hope we can keep hold of him next year but he is one player who has shown true Championship quality this year.



Prediction for the game?


Form doesn't get much worse, but we're at home and I feel obliged to back us for a draw. Wouldn't be suprised by any result though!




Many thanks to Ian again for his views.
